in that

  1. In the fact that; in the sense that; for the cause or reason that; because.
    This essay is a good one in that it comprehensively outlines all the major arguments on this issue.
    • Hooker
      Some things they do in that they are men [] ; some things in that they are men misled and blinded with error.
